咳镘袁 发表于 2025-6-5 09:18:55

使用verilog生成各种CRC校验码

一、功能介绍

在FPGA进行各种接口通信时,经常会出现对方发来的数据带有CRC校验码,如CRC5、CRC8、CRC16、CRC32等,为了适应不同的情况,我们使用Verilog实现了一个比较通用的CRC计算模块,可生成CRC5/CRC8/CRC16/CRC32等各种宽度的CRC校验码,满足不同场景下的CRC校验需求。
二、模块调用示例

此模块可实现各种相关参数的重配置:如下图所示,可实现CRC输出宽度可配置, 输入数据宽度可配置, 初始值可配置, 多项式可配置。
此模块已在多个项目中验证通过,保证正常可用,如需此模块的底层Verilog代码,可联系我们的技术支持QQ 3852490603,有偿提供,研发不易请君理解。
使用时直接调用即可,调用示例如下:

 
 
 
 

如您有此功能的定制开发或其他的FPGA设计需求,请查看下面这篇文章了解我们的业务范围和联系方式,我们将竭诚为您服务。
精橙FPGA,一个承接FPGA代码设计的资深工程师团队。

 

来源:程序园用户自行投稿发布,如果侵权,请联系站长删除
免责声明:如果侵犯了您的权益,请联系站长,我们会及时删除侵权内容,谢谢合作!

邹语彤 发表于 2025-10-17 00:43:59

前排留名,哈哈哈

歇凛尾 发表于 2025-11-20 17:45:14

这个有用。

仰翡邸 发表于 2025-11-27 09:53:37

鼓励转贴优秀软件安全工具和文档!

莅耸 发表于 2025-12-1 01:31:04

新版吗?好像是停更了吧。

都淑贞 发表于 2025-12-15 17:30:06

感谢,下载保存了

聚怪闩 发表于 2026-1-14 03:25:22

谢谢分享,辛苦了

尹心菱 发表于 2026-1-17 20:46:13

很好很强大我过来先占个楼 待编辑

里豳朝 发表于 2026-1-18 13:33:48

不错,里面软件多更新就更好了

缑莺韵 发表于 2026-1-19 00:08:36

谢谢楼主提供!

奚娅琼 发表于 2026-1-21 09:47:42

yyds。多谢分享

匣卒 发表于 2026-1-24 02:02:16

感谢分享

汪玉珂 发表于 2026-1-24 07:54:52

过来提前占个楼

庾签 发表于 2026-1-25 12:20:25

感谢分享

凌彦慧 发表于 2026-1-29 03:58:55

感谢分享,下载保存了,貌似很强大

瞧蛀 发表于 2026-2-1 09:41:29

分享、互助 让互联网精神温暖你我

雌鲳签 发表于 2026-2-8 09:16:10

新版吗?好像是停更了吧。

揿纰潦 发表于 2026-2-8 16:08:42

过来提前占个楼

赵淳美 发表于 2026-2-9 00:06:05

谢谢分享,辛苦了

公西颖初 发表于 2026-2-9 03:25:35

喜欢鼓捣这些软件,现在用得少,谢谢分享!
页: [1] 2
查看完整版本: 使用verilog生成各种CRC校验码